Concept introduction:
According to Huckel’s rule a planar, cyclic conjugated system will be aromatic if it contains (4n+2)Ï€ electrons. Systems with 4nÏ€ electrons will be antiaromatic.
Resonance structures differ only in the position of lone pair or its π electrons. The position of atoms in different resonance forms do not differ. They do not represent the actual structure of the molecule. The actual structure is a hybrid of all the resonance forms possible.
